Book one in a 6 book series  The Romans had taken Britain and made it their own, but when the Roman Empire collapses on itself, the Roman legions leave the fringes of the Empire and draw back toward the center, to Rome. Leaving Britannia defenseless against the Saxon barbarians.

She was a Roman Briton and she embodied all that Rome stood for. He hated her on sight. She, proudly Roman, fought him with every breath. He burned his way into her life, destroying the world as she knew it, and she vowed to fight him to the death, either hers or his.

He was a Saxon warrior and stood for everything she loathed and feared. He was a beast, an animal...a barbarian. He destroyed her villa by fire and then stayed to torment her, finding joy in her despair, playing out his revenge upon her until he grew bored with his game and decided to kill her.

The hate they felt for each other burned with a fiery blaze, yet when he touched her, she trembled. They felt only hatred burning in their souls...or was it respect, admiration, and even love?
